Resident Evil Requiem: a long gameplay video from Japan

After a first taste at Opening Night Live, a new gameplay video of Resident Evil Requiem has now emerged, which finally shows us something more substantial. The footage, published by the Japanese magazine Famitsu, focuses on the protagonist Grace Ashcroft, chased by a frightening creature.

In the video, which you can view at the bottom of the news, we see Grace hunted by an imposing and terrifying female creature. Armed only with a lighter to make our way through the darkness of creepy corridors and rooms, we will have to escape and find a hiding place to safety. The tension is palpable, also because the monster seems able to suddenly appear in front of us or break down doors to reach us, keeping us constantly under pressure. If the creature manages to get too close, it can also grab and bite us.

The sequence shows how the only momentary salvation is represented by well-lit areas. When Grace manages to reach a lighted room, in fact, the creature cannot follow her, as the light seems to have an effect on her skin. This game mechanic confirms a leak that emerged earlier, according to which this "stalker" does not tolerate bright light, suggesting that we will have to use the environment to our advantage to survive. Another rumor had previously suggested that the monster is none other than Alyssa Ashcroft, the mother of the protagonist.

The final part of the video shows us Grace in a completely different room, turned upside down and stained with blood, as she climbs on a table to retrieve a screwdriver from a toolbox, an object that will evidently be useful for her to continue.
